Marko Bjelaković has authored 11 papers that have received a total of 687 indexed citations.
This includes 4 papers in Epidemiology, 3 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. The topics of these papers are Renal and related cancers (3 papers), Vitamin D Research Studies (3 papers) and Vitamin C and Antioxidants Research (2 papers). Marko Bjelaković is often cited by papers focused on Renal and related cancers (3 papers), Vitamin D Research Studies (3 papers) and Vitamin C and Antioxidants Research (2 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Serbia, Denmark and Italy. Marko Bjelaković's co-authors include Christian Gluud, Goran Bjelaković, Dimitrinka Nikolova, Rosa G Simonetti and Aleksandar Nagorni and has published in prestigious journals such as Cochrane library, Journal of Hepatology and Alimentary Pharmacology & Therapeutics.
